Description

Tesamorelin is a synthetic analogue of endogenous growth-hormone-releasing hormone (GHRH), reproducing all 44 amino acids of the native human sequence with the addition of a trans-3-hexenoic acid moiety at the N-terminus [5]. This structural modification distinguishes it from unmodified GHRH and is the subject of ongoing biochemical investigation into how terminal conjugation influences receptor binding kinetics and peptide stability. The compound is classified among growth hormone secretagogues alongside related analogues such as sermorelin and CJC-1295 [2].

In laboratory and preclinical contexts, tesamorelin has been employed to investigate GHRH receptor signaling, pituitary somatotroph response dynamics, and the downstream cascade that includes IGF-1 pathway activation and satellite cell biology [2]. Researchers studying endocrine regulation of adipose tissue distribution and metabolic parameters have used it as a reference compound in controlled experimental designs [4]. Its defined sequence and well-characterized receptor target make it a useful molecular tool for probing the somatotropic axis.

Beyond endocrine signaling studies, tesamorelin has appeared in preclinical and clinical research examining body composition endpoints, including visceral and hepatic fat quantification via imaging modalities such as MRI and dual-energy X-ray absorptiometry [4]. Investigators have also referenced its pharmacological profile in broader comparative reviews of peptide compounds relevant to tissue metabolism and musculoskeletal research models [1][3].
